Ice machince is going max freeze cycle shut down

1. Possible cause. Water leak. Check purge valve, water curtain, sump, sump hose.
2. Air filters clogged. Clean air filters.
3. Dirty condenser. Clean condenser.
4. Restricted location, intake air to hot. Have machine moved.
5. Ice thickness sensor dirty or disconnected. Check ice thickness sensor probe.
6. Water distributor dirty. Remove and clean water distributor.
7. Inlet water valve leaks through during freeze cycle. Check water inlet valve.
8. Connected to hot water. Check for bleed through from missing check valve in building water supply.
9. Incomplete harvest. Check harvest system.
10.High pressure cut out opened. Check fan motor pressure control, check fan motor, check controller using test mode.
11. Fan motor pressure control open. Check fan pressure control.
12. Fan motor not turning. Check fan motor, check fan blade,check controller using test mode.
13.Water pump not pumping. Check pump motor,check controller using test mode.
14. Pump hose disconnected. Check hose.
15. Compressor not operating. check compressor contactor, check controller using test mode.
Check compressor start components, check PTCR resistance and temperature, check compressor voltage, check compressor windings.
16. Low refrigerant charge. Add some refrigerant and restart unit. If cycle time imporves, look for a leak.
17. Hot gas valve leaks through during freeze. Check hot gas valve for hot outlet during freeze.
18. Thermostatic expansion valve bulb loose. Check bulb.
19. Thermostatic expansion valve producing very low or high superheat. Check evaporator superheat, Change TXV if incorrect.
20. Compressor inefficent. Check compressor amp draw, if low and all else is correcy, change compressor.

Scotsman c0330 is not making ice and display code flashing 8

Low room temperature - Most Scotsman ice makers won't produce ice when the temperature is below 55 degrees Fahrenheit. Make sure the machine is in a room or setting that is warmer. ... Faulty thermistor - A bad thermistor usually causes the bin to fill with too much ice.


Diagnostic Codes


  • 1 - Long freeze time. Shutting down.
  • 1 (flashing) - Retrying long freeze cycle.
  • 2 - Long harvest time. Shutting down.
  • 2 (flashing) - Retrying long harvest cycle.
  • 3 - Water filling slowly.
  • 4 - High discharging temperature.
  • 5 - Failed sump temp sensor.
  • 7 - Failed discharge temp sensor.
  • 8 - Thin ice from short freeze cycle.
  • 8 (flashing) - Retrying short freeze cycle.

Which error e1 of hoshizaki ice maker fm-170ake

E1, means low ice production
Ice machine cycle takes to long to call for a harvest. When this happens it should shut the whole unit down and then show the error code. Reset power supply, Turn off then Turn on the machine. Check for these problems. Gas leaking by the hot gas valve when in freeze mode, this valve should only let hot gas by when it is in a harvest mode. Check water control valve to make sure it is not letting water in during freeze cycle. Check water float switch to make sure it is not stuck calling for water during freeze cycle. Also make sure the machine is not in a hot location, the hotter the ambient surrounding air entering the condenser coil the longer it takes to make ice.

Makes ice for 3 cycles then stops running.Can turn off then on again to make more ice for a couple more cycles.

check the cycle time for a batch of ice. should take around 15 minutes to freeze and then you will hear the harvest cycle kick in. If the harvest cycle takes 3 minutes or more that is your problem. You will need to get a hold of NICKEL SAFE ICE MACHINE CLEANER. DO NOT use CLR or any kind of cleaner other than NICKEL SAFE ICE MACHINE CLEANER. If the ice doesn't fall off of the plate in about 90 seconds either the plate is dirty or the nickel plating has come off. There is a failsafe shut down if the unit takes more than 60 minutes to freeze or more than 3 minutes to harvest 3 consecutive times. The cleaning instructions should be inside of one of the covers. I have some problem with our machine scotsman mv450 is to long product ice very slowly

Min freeze time 6 minutes and max freeze time 45 minutes. the 6 minutes is with perfect conditions. Example: Cycle time water temp was 50 degrees coming in to the water sump tray from water supply and the Ambient air temp surrounding the machine was a constant 70 deg than the machine should make ice every 10 - 12 minutes.now we know that the water temp from the water source is not going to be 50 deg and room temp will not be 70 deg all the time so the warmer water temp and ambient air temp is the longer it takes to make ice. one thing you wont to check is the water inlet valve to make sure it is not letting water seep through causing water temp not to cool down from running across evap plates. make sure the condenser coil is clean this will slow down production of ice.

The freezer isn't making alot of ice. Can the hose behind the ice maker freeze?

Hi and welcome to FixYa, I am Kelly.

When a refrigerator slows down ice production it is usually the result of poor air-flow through the evaporator coils. The poor air-flow is due to ice build up on the evaporator coils. The ice build up happens because the unit is not defrosting properly or the evaporator fan is not running at full speed.

To answer your question "Can an Ice-maker tube freeze?" Yes, they can and do freeze but when they do freeze that is caused by a defective inlet water valve that is leaking water by when it is supposed to be shut off. It can freeze if some one set the temp control to MAX cold. Additionally when they do freeze and the Ice-maker cycles the plastic hose on the back of the unit pops out of the ice maker tube and each cycle starts porting ice maker fill water on the floor.

This may sound odd.. but. Perform a manual defrost by removing the freezer contents and directing a fan into the freezer compartment for just over 2 hours. (Makes a water mess so do not leave it unattended) The return the unit to normal service and after 8 hours start watching the amount of ice produced. (Should be normal for 2 days!) If after 2 days the ice production slows again you have an automatic defrosting problem that is causing the ice build up on the evaporator coils.

What should be kept clean?
There are 5 things to keep clean:
1. The outside cabinet & door.
2. The ice storage bin.
3. The condenser.
4. The ice making system.
5. The ice scoop.
The ice storage bin should be sanitized
occasionally. It is usually convenient to sanitize the
bin after the ice making system has been cleaned,
and the storage bin is empty.
A sanitizing solution can be made of 1 ounce of
household bleach and two gallons of hot (950F. -
1150F.) water. Use a clean cloth and wipe the
interior of the ice storage bin with the sanitizing
solution, pour some of the solution down the drain.
Allow to air dry.

How to clean the condenser.
The condenser is like the radiator on a car, it has
fins and tubes that can become clogged. To clean:
1. Remove the kickplate.
2. Locate the condenser surface.
3. Vacuum the surface, removing all dust and lint.
Caution: Do not dent the fins.
4. Replace the kickplate.
Winterizing
1. Clean the machine as explained on the next
page.
2. Turn off the water supply.
3. Drain the water reservoir. See page 24, Spray
Pump Repair and follow the instructions to remove
the pump hose (step 2, bottom hose only).
4. Disconnect the incoming water line at the inlet
water valve.
5Remove control box cover and turn the timer
into the harvest cycle.
6. With the machine operating, blow air through
the inlet water valve; a tire pump could do the job.
7. Drain pump models should have about 1¤2 gallon
of RV antifreeze (propylene glycol) poured into the
ice storage bin drain.
Note: Automotive antifreeze must NOT be used.
8. Replace control box cover. Switch off and
unplug the machine.

CUBE ADJUSTMENTS
There are three items that may be adjusted: Cube
Size, Harvest Time, and Bin Level. Note: Cube
Size and Harvest Time adjustments should only be
done by a qualified service person.
Cube size control.
The cube size control should only be adjusted to
bring the cubes to the correct shape, the overall
size cannot be adjusted. Try to adjust the cube
size control when the ice machine is in the harvest
cycle, or in the first 10 minutes of the freeze cycle.
1. Open the door and remove the control box
cover.
2. Locate the cube size adjustment screw, and to
make fuller cubes, turn the screw clockwise about
1/4 turn. This will make the freezing cycle longer.
3. To shorten the freezing cycle and make cubes
that are not as full, turn the adjustment screw 1/4
turn counterclockwise.
4. After the next freezing cycle, the cubes should
have responded to the adjustment, if another
adjustment is required, do it early in the freeze
cycle.

Hoshizaki Ice Machine Model KM-500MAF

(Quated From Hoshizaki Technical Bulletin)
An alarm code of 3 beeps
every 3 seconds means that the control board has shut
down on the 60 minute freeze cycle back up timer.

The “E” control board has a 60 minute timer that starts at
the beginning of the freeze cycle. If the float switch fails
to open and start the next harvest within 60 minutes, the
board will automatically start the harvest cycle. If this
occurs in two consecutive cycles, the control board will
shut the unit down on the manual reset, freeze cycle
back- up timer. The yellow fault LED marked “60 min.”
will illuminate. This safety is designed to help prevent a
freeze up of the evaporator.

Once you have identified the 60 minute alarm, there are
several things to check. Reset the alarm by depressing
the white reset button to the right of the fault LED’s.
This must be done with the power “ON”. Now check the
float switch to see if it is stuck in the up position. A stuck
float can occur if scale is present on the reed switch
shaft inside the housing. To check it, drain the water
reservoir, unplug the black float switch connector (K5)
from the control board and check it with an ohm meter
for a closed switch (zero ohms). If the float switch is
sticking, clean it with ice machine cleaner or replace it as
necessary.
An inlet water valve which is slowly leaking by during the
freeze cycle can cause a 60 minute alarm. If the inlet
water valve is stuck wide open, it is unlikely that any ice
will form on the evaporator. Check for a slow leak by
allowing the unit to cycle into the freeze cycle and
disconnecting the hose at the outlet of the water valve. If
water leaks by during the freeze cycle, the water valve
diaphragm is likely damaged or the small diaphragm bleed
port is clogged with scale. Clean the bleed port or replace
the diaphragm or entire water valve as necessary.

(I Recommend to get a refrigeration tech for this part).

Another possibility is a refrigeration system problem. You
should use normal refrigeration diagnosis procedures to
check for one of these problems. If the thermostatic
expansion valve is not feeding properly or the refrigerant
charge is low, the evaporator will not form ice as it should
and a long freeze cycle will occur. This could also be the
result of the hot gas valve not closing completely during
the freeze cycle or if the compressor valves are weak or
inefficient. An inefficient compressor however, will
usually show up first on the KM model through a longer
than normal harvest cycle. This is because of cooler
than normal discharge gas. Use proper refrigeration
practices to repair a refrigeration system problem.
While these are not the only reasons for a 60 minute
freeze cycle, they are the most common and should be
checked to resolve a 3 beep/yellow fault LED alarm.
